Skidmore, Owings & Merrill (SOM) is a collective of over 1,200 architects, designers, engineers, and planners working across studios in London, Chicago, New York, San Francisco, Los Angeles, Washington D.C., Hong Kong, Melbourne, Riyadh and Dubai.
Responsibilities
- Oversee the commercial success of major projects, leading program, delivery and fee management.
- Coordinate SOM’s design team from early concept through delivery, ensuring constructability, performance and quality.
- Engage multidisciplinary teams to support coordination and solve complex challenges with creativity and clarity.
- Mentor the next generation of talent and contribute to a dynamic, design‑led culture.
Qualifications
- Licensed (preferred) architect with 10+ years experience leading large‑scale, complex projects.
- Passionate advocate for impactful and sustainable design.
- Natural leader who energizes and inspires interdisciplinary teams.
- Excellent communicator capable of contributing to all stages of the project life‑cycle from acquisition of new work through to completion.
- Experience in Europe or the Middle East, preferably within transport, government, commercial, residential or mixed‑use development.
